2009-09-05 23:41:40 Description: The first irony is that there's a whore, or courtesan, who lives on Madonna Street. Next is that the John who comes to see her must say he's the utilities serviceman, come "for the (More) The first irony is that there's a whore, or courtesan, who lives on Madonna Street. Next is that the John who comes to see her must say he's the utilities serviceman, come "for the gas." After that, we find that the respectable men in town from bourgeoisie and the working class, are also there "for the gas." It's like prohibibition era speakeasy where everyone had to give a password to get in. "Jacques Brel"of the Dialogus website says the essence of this song is about "text and pretext", hypocrisy, people pretending to be what they're not. The assemblage of men in this small funky house reminded Brel of the Marx Brothers famous cabin scene. Ema, of Rennes France tells me "my sisters hand" reminds her of an expression, "My sister's hand in the pants of a Zouave." Brel's hand gesture seems to confirm that.Thank's to Ema for her help with the translation of this funny song, full of alliterations and poetic devices best listened to in French. 2009-09-05 23:41:50 Description: Jacques Brel's hommage to his departed best friend, right-hand man, chauffeur, secretary, manager, confident, "ami du coeur," Georges Pasquier called Jojo. They met in 1954 and remained (More) Jacques Brel's hommage to his departed best friend, right-hand man, chauffeur, secretary, manager, confident, "ami du coeur," Georges Pasquier called Jojo. They met in 1954 and remained inseparable friends all through life ("L'ami Jojo" of Les Bourgeois) until Jojo's death from cancer in 1974. The depth and longevity of this relationship led Brel to celebrate "l'amiti," friendship as preferable to "l'amour," love, which often ends in bitterness and disappointment. His last private plane which he flew in the Marquesas bore the name "Jojo." (See it at the end of the video.) After Jojo died Jacques suffered a deep depression and a month later found he had lung cancer. This song was taken from his last album, the song of dying man's undying love for his best friend. 2008-04-21 16:18:10 Description: "SIMPLY MARVELOUS" -- Geoffrey Holder A rare performance and glimpse into the "life and philosophy" of this multi-talented celebrity. Immediately recognizable as the 7-Up, (More) "SIMPLY MARVELOUS" -- Geoffrey Holder A rare performance and glimpse into the "life and philosophy" of this multi-talented celebrity. Immediately recognizable as the 7-Up, "Uncola man", his distinctive bass voice, heavy accent and hearty laugh are legendary. This is a clip from his "nightclub act" that was filmed at Joe's Pub at the Public Theater, New York City. Geoffrey is 6'6" tall and shaved his head long before it was cool. Geoffrey won the 1975 Tony Award for Best Direction of a Musical for his staging of the Broadway musical, "The Wiz" (1975), the all-African American retelling of "The Wizard of Oz." That same year he was also awarded the Tony for best costume design and was nominated again for the original 1978 Broadway musical "Timbuktu!", which he also directed and choreographed. As a choreographer, he has created dance pieces for many companies, including the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ater and The Dance Theatre of Harlem. Painter, director, set and costume designer, choreographer, dancer, actor, musician and showman; Geoffrey Holder is both colleague and friend to many, many international celebrities: Alvin Ailey, Woody Allen / Everything You Always Wanted to Know About Sex (But Were Afraid to Ask), Harold Arlen /House of Flowers, Charles Aznavour, George Balanchine / House of Flowers, Pearl Bailey / House of Flowers, Josephine Baker / Josephine Baker and Her Company, Ray Bolger/ Tony Award Presenter, Jacques Brel, Truman Capote / House of Flowers, Diahann Carroll / House of Flowers, Carol Channing / costumes, Noel Coward / Androcles and the Lion, Bette Davis, Johnny Depp / Charlie and the Chocolate Factory / Reader, Marlene Dietrich, Duke Ellington, Ian Fleming / Live or Let Die, Joao Gilberto Amoroso / Brasil / cover, James Earl Jones / Swashbuckler, Grace Jones / Boomerang, Martha Graham, Rex Harrison / Doctor Dolittle as William Shakespeare the Tenth, Helen Hays, Lena Horne / portrait, John Huston / Annie as Punjab, Michael Jackson, Brian Keith, Eartha Kitt / Boomerang / Timbuktu / Director, Claude Lelouch / Hasards of Coincidences, Stephanie Mills / The Wiz/director, Sal Mineo / Aladdin, Arthur Mitchell / Dance Theatre of Harlem, Ricardo Montalban / portrait, Melba Moore /Timbuktu, Roger Moore / James Bond / Live or Let Die / actor / choreographer, Eddie Murphy / Boomerang, Odetta, Anthony Perkins / portrait, Sidney Poitier, Herbert Ross / House of Flowers / Doctor Dolittle, Maximillan Schell, Jane Seymour / Live or Let Die, Bobby Short, Nina Simone, Charlie Smalls, Sharon Stone / Inspired her to "leave home and go into the business", Gloria Swanson and the list goes on... Much like his longtime friend Bill Cosby, Geoffrey is both teacher and Renaissance man. When he commands the audience to "STAND UP, UP, UP, UP!" and then insists that everyone "PLEDGE ALLEGIANCE" to GOD, THE FATHER ALMIGHTY, THE MAKER OF HEAVEN AND EARTH, to JESUS, MOSES, BUDDAH AND ALLAH... He is more EVANGELIST than SHOWMAN. Geoffrey burns with THEOSOPHY and UNIVERSAL LOVE. Born in Port of Spain, Trinidad, Geoffrey came to New York City in 1952. Holder married dancer, choreographer and actress, Carmine DeLavallade in June of 1955. They met when they were both were in the Broadway cast of "Flower Drum Song". 2008-04-22 10:57:17 Description: RUFUS WAINWRIGHT, son of the folk singers Loudon Wainwright III and Kate McGarrigle, and brother of the also singer Martha Wainwright, Rufus was born in Rhinebeck, New York in 1973, although he grew (More) RUFUS WAINWRIGHT, son of the folk singers Loudon Wainwright III and Kate McGarrigle, and brother of the also singer Martha Wainwright, Rufus was born in Rhinebeck, New York in 1973, although he grew up in Montreal, Canada. Much has been said and written about his stormy adolescence and his substance abuse problem and of the impossible loves that have marked his music, but nothing can tarnish a talent that seems destined to be up there with the greats. He's proud to imbibe the essence of artists like Scott Walker, Jacques Brel or Edith Piaf on albums such as Rufus Wainwright (98) --Best New Artist in Rolling Stone Magazine -, Poses (01), Want one (03) or Want two (04), which all display a talent not common these days. Along with French songs, his influences include opera, musicals and cabaret. Excessive, ironic, baroque... Rufus, who adores Franz Schubert and Judy Garland equally, has also worked on soundtracks for films like The Aviator, The Diary of Bridget Jones, I am Sam, Zoolander, Shrek and Moulin Rouge, to name but a few. On Release the stars, his fifth album, with its status as a classic already guaranteed, he has once again proved that as well as a composer and an incredible performer, he's the best in melodramatic pop. All his new songs continue to ooze both opulence and intimacy, and the contrasts of an artist who is possibly more theatrical than musical.
